When expressing "way" in Japanese, you must carefully distinguish between "途中", "途中に", "活路", "陰陽道" based on context.
  • 途中 (とちゅう (tochuu) - Level: N4): Maps to "on the way; in the middle of" and is used when 何かをしている最中や、目的地へ向かう道中に使います。.
  • 途中に (とちゅうに (tochuu ni) - Level: N3): Maps to "on the way; in the middle of" and is used when Indicates that something happens or exists during a journey, process, or period. It implies an event occurring 'while' something else is ongoing or 'en route' to a destination..
  • 活路 (かつろ (katsuro) - Level: N1): Maps to "a way out, a means of escape, a lifeline, a path to survival" and is used when Refers to finding a solution or path to overcome a difficult or desperate situation, especially when one is cornered or facing a crisis. Often used with 「を見出す」..
  • 陰陽道 (おんみょうどう (onmyoudou) - Level: C2): Maps to "the way of yin and yang" and is used when Essential structural term in CEFR C2 vocabulary syllabus..

Context for "途中"
学校へ行く途中で、友達に会いました。
I met a friend on the way to school.
Context for "途中に"
会社に行く途中に、コンビニに寄りました。
On my way to work, I stopped by a convenience store.
Context for "活路"
絶体絶命の状況から活路を見出すのは困難だった。
It was difficult to find a way out from a desperate situation.
Context for "陰陽道"
私は陰陽道に興味があります。
I am interested in the way of yin and yang.
